What's in a Name?

Since going live on Facebook, we have received several inquiries regarding location and opening hours. It seems that a large portion of our followers is under the impression that GOOD TACO is a Mexican restaurant. While the name was indeed inspired by the souvenir markets of Mexico, the term is actually the brainchild of Cindy Tuddenham, and refers to a failsafe and semi-scientific method to label aesthetic choices as either good or poor. The line between good and bad taco can be quite difficult to identify and in anticipation of confusion we have included photo examples below for reference purposes. Please contact us if you require further clarification and/or guidance. And for goodness' sake, please stop placing orders for tacos con carne!
